Street art has long been a means for people to express themselves, and it’s frequently used to make political statements or spread a message to the general public. Murals are among the most well-liked kind of street art. Murals have the ability to completely change the appearance of a building or a public area with their vivid colors and elaborate designs. However, are murals anonymous? They can, in a nutshell, which is true. In actuality, a lot of street artists opt to maintain their anonymity by concealing their true name behind a tag or a pseudonym.

Street art culture has always been heavily influenced by anonymity. It enables artists to freely express themselves without worrying about criticism or retaliation. Because they want their art to speak for itself without any personal bias or preconceptions, many street artists decide to maintain their anonymity. Additionally, anonymity lends the painting a sense of mystery that enhances its allure.

But how are the murals produced by unidentified street artists? There are various methods for doing it. Some artists produce their works using stencils or posters, which enables them to rapidly and covertly apply their artwork on a surface. Others cover their tracks or operate in empty areas while using spray paint or other materials to construct their murals.

It can be difficult, but anonymity allows street artists to express themselves freely. Without a well-known identity, it may be challenging to market their product or receive recognition. Social media is a popular platform for unidentified street artists to promote their work and get fans. To increase their exposure, some people work with other artists or groups.

The controversy surrounding the legality of street art is expanding along with its popularity. In some cities, street art is accepted as a genuine art form, and murals made by street artists are permitted to be shown in public areas. Some have prohibited it due to worries about vandalism and property damage. Regardless of your position on the matter, it is undeniable that street art, particularly murals, has the ability to move, provoke, and confront us in ways that traditional art does not.
